MUSC Health Primary Care - North Charleston is a medical clinic in North Charleston, SC. The practice delivers both in‑person office visits and online video appointments, offering family medicine, internal medicine, primary care, flu shots, child and adolescent psychiatry, and virtual care to patients of all ages. Located within the North Charleston Medical Pavilion, the clinic provides convenient access to additional MUSC Health specialty services and serves the surrounding community with a 4.8‑star rating based on four reviews.
The care team includes physicians such as Dr. Joseph R. Mazuk, D.O., MS, who focuses on family medicine, Dr. Daniel Alden Williams, M.D., specializing in internal medicine and primary care, and Nurse Practitioner Farrin Honeycutt Freeman, FNP‑C, who provides primary care services. Psychiatric care is available through Robert Sutter, DNP, PMHNP, MPA, who treats children and adolescents. The clinic emphasizes quality, compassionate care and offers new‑patient visits, flu vaccinations, and the option of virtual consultations to meet diverse health needs.
The facility sits on University Boulevard, directly adjacent to the main road of the same name. It is a short walk of about 0.2 miles from HCA Healthcare Trident Hospital, roughly 0.3 miles from Charleston Southern University, and approximately 0.3 miles from Rivers Library, placing it within easy reach of key community landmarks.
